Airport Limousine Transfer: Stockholm City to Arlanda Airport 1-7 Passengers
When you have to get to Stockholm Arlanda Airport, the annoying part is not the car, it is everything around it. This private transfer is interesting because you start with a driver who will meet you and handle the handoff smoothly, so you spend less time hunting, waiting, and guessing. I like the clear promise of punctual pickup and the practical onboard extras like WiFi and phone chargers. The main thing to consider is that this is a private, booked-in-advance service, so it is pricier than public transit or a rideshare.
What I like most is how the service is built for real travel stress, especially airport mornings. You get English-speaking chauffeurs, a discreet vehicle choice, and help with baggage at arrival time, plus free bottled water to keep you comfy while you cross town. One possible drawback: if you are traveling with a child and need a car seat, that is not included and you will need to pay extra.
Bottom line, this is a good option when you want your Stockholm to Arlanda day to feel boring in the best way, meaning smooth and predictable. In a set of past trips, a driver named Jon was singled out for being early and friendly, which matches the overall theme here, attentive and on time.

Price and Value for a Car, Not Just a Ride
The price is listed at $228.10 per group, and it is described as up to 3 passengers for that rate. At the same time, the overall service notes 1 to 7 passengers, so you should double-check the exact vehicle fit and headcount when you book.
Is it expensive? Compared to public transit, yes. Compared to the true cost of time and stress at the end (or beginning) of a trip, it can be fair. You are paying for a driver you can count on, a vehicle that is ready, and a service that bundles in the stuff that often becomes annoying later.
The biggest value clues are these:
- All taxes, fuel surcharges, and service fees are included
- Meet and greet is included
- Free bottled water is included
- WiFi and phone chargers are included
Also, the transfer duration is about 40 minutes, which means you are usually buying a short, focused window of reliable transport, not a half-day commitment. For groups who share the cost, it can end up feeling like a smarter way to buy peace of mind.

Small Details That Can Affect Your Day
This service includes many of the annoying extras, but a few items are worth knowing up front.
1) Child seats are not included
A child seat is listed as not included, with a cost of 300 SEK. If you are traveling with a baby or small child, plan for that cost and confirm availability during booking.
2) Bottled water and WiFi are included
This matters more than it sounds. Water keeps you comfortable while you wait for the airport rhythm to start. WiFi helps you keep your flight info in front of you.
3) Service animals are allowed
If you are traveling with a service animal, it is explicitly allowed. That is a helpful checkbox for peace of mind.
4) Airport help is built into the meet and greet
You should expect help from the driver when meeting you and getting you to the vehicle. The feedback also mentioned baggage assistance, which is exactly the kind of help that makes airport transfers feel worth it.

FAQ
How long is the transfer from Stockholm to Arlanda?
The transfer is listed at approximately 40 minutes.
How much does the service cost?
The price is $228.10 per group (up to 3 passengers) as listed.
What is included in the price?
Included items listed for the service are bottled water, 10 minutes of waiting time, an air-conditioned vehicle, WiFi on board, and private transportation. Taxes, fuel surcharges, and service fees are also included.
Do you get meet and greet at pickup?
Yes. Meet and greet service is included, and the driver will meet you and help you to the vehicle.
Is WiFi available in the vehicle?
Yes. WiFi is included on board.
What kinds of vehicles might you use?
The service lists Mercedes S-Class, E-Class, V-Class, and BMW 5 Series and 7 Series options.
Is there waiting time if I am delayed?
Yes. You get 10 minutes of waiting time included.
Is a child seat included?
No. A child seat is not included and is listed at 300 SEK.
Can I cancel for free?
Yes, free cancellation is available. You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
